I found this Cent in a roll of 57's my Mom gave me. At first I thought it was just the neck line. Then when I checked further I realized it's a die crack.
I was told UV light does not enhance an error, but in this case it really makes the crack stand out.
I've added another 1957-D to compare the neck line to.
